Dearing, KS vs Earlton, KS
The cost of living difference between Dearing, KS and Earlton, KS is dramatic. Dearing is 43.2% cheaper than Earlton,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Dearing has a cost index of 55 while Earlton sits at 96,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.
Median household income in Dearing is $59,688 compared to $73,833 in Earlton (-19.2%). Earlton does offer higher incomes, but the salary premium barely offsets the higher cost of living, leaving residents with a tighter budget.
Climate-wise, both cities share similar average temperatures (58.8°F vs 58°F). Earlton receives more rainfall at 40.7" per year compared to 40.4" in Dearing.
